Transaction 58a470a00f285b9d1d47923e4b8b30042eefde46212753d7bc69820be36e0836
1 Input
1 Output
-
58a470a00f285b9d1d47923e4b8b30042eefde46212753d7bc69820be36e0836:0
- value
- 17999071
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fff1b1b6168624d6a01531eee1e439f8bb7bbc4
- address
- bc1q8ll3kxmpdp3y66sp2v0wu8jrn79m0w7yxrnf76